Double glazing is made with two panes of glass separated by a bar that is spaced to create an air gap that is filled with insulating gas. This helps to make your home more energy efficient by keeping the cold outside and warm inside. It also reduces outside noise pollution by reducing the transmission of sound into your home. These benefits are great for older homes that often have single glazed windows that are not energy efficient.

You can save money on your energy bills by replacing these old windows. This can be accomplished by upgrading your existing sash window with double glazing. This is a reasonably affordable option in comparison to other window replacements because the installation is simple.

The cost of a new sash window will depend on the size, material and complexity of the design. The cost of full-frame replacements is higher due to the extra materials and labour required. Replications for historic homes require a custom-designed project and meticulous attention to detail, which adds to the overall cost. Adding extra features like weatherstripping or glass that is energy efficient will also increase the cost.

The longevity of your new sliding windows depends on the installation. To ensure a perfect fit and prevent drafts or water intrusion, it is essential to measure precisely. It is also essential to finish and seal your installation correctly to increase the efficiency.

Before you decide to purchase new sash windows, it's essential to check with your local conservation office or council to see whether there are any restrictions on the type of window you can install. If you reside in a listed building, you may need planning permission to replace your existing windows.
